U.S. Adolescent Rest-Activity patterns: insights from functional principal component analysis (NHANES 2011-2014)

Adolescent rest-activity patterns are linked to adult health. Demographic and socioeconomic factors significantly influence these rest-activity rhythms in adolescents, highlighting potential intervention targets.
Area of Science:
- Chronobiology
- Adolescent Health
- Sociodemographics
Background:
- Suboptimal rest-activity patterns in adolescence are linked to adverse adult health outcomes.
- Understanding sociodemographic influences on adolescent rest-activity rhythms is crucial for targeted interventions.
Purpose of the Study:
- To investigate the association between demographic and socioeconomic characteristics and rest-activity rhythms in adolescents.
- To identify specific subgroups of adolescents who may benefit from interventions aimed at improving rest-activity patterns.
Main Methods:
- Utilized cross-sectional data from the National Health and Nutrition Examination Survey (NHANES) 2011-2014.
- Derived rest-activity profiles from 7-day accelerometry data using functional principal component analysis.
- Employed multiple linear regression to assess associations between participant characteristics and rest-activity profiles, with separate analyses for weekdays and weekends.
Main Results:
- Identified four distinct rest-activity profiles: High amplitude, Early activity window, Early activity peak, and Prolonged activity/reduced rest window.
- Found significant associations between rest-activity profiles and age, sex, race/ethnicity, and household income.
- Older adolescents, girls, certain racial/ethnic minorities, and those with lower income exhibited distinct rest-activity patterns.
Conclusions:
- Characterized key rest-activity profiles in US adolescents.
- Demonstrated that demographic and socioeconomic factors significantly shape adolescent rest-activity behaviors.
- Findings underscore the importance of considering individual characteristics when addressing adolescent sleep and activity patterns.
